cape

망토cape

A 망토 is a cape, a piece of clothing that covers your shoulders and back. People often wear it with costumes, in shows, or as a stylish outer layer. In pictures, it usually looks like a long cloth without sleeves.

beret

베레모beret

A beret (베레모) is a soft, flat, round hat. People wear it for style, uniforms, or cold weather. You can use this word when talking about clothes, shopping, or what someone is wearing.
